BEAR CUBS GO WILD

Thanks to your donations and adoptions, 14 orphans are returning to the wild in Russia. Rescued as helpless cubs, the tiny bears needed regular bottle-feeds, then porridge and eggs, before learning to forage for roots and berries prior to release. READ MORE ( [link removed] )

AWARD WINNERS

You chose spider monkeys. Nearly 18,000 of you voted in the People’s Choice category of our annual McKenna-Travers Awards. Fernanda Abra was the resounding winner for her visionary bridges, built to help rare monkeys cross busy roads in the Amazon.

TURTLES SWIM FREE

Thanks to supporters who contacted Born Free, we raised concerns about two marine turtles kept in terrible conditions at an aquarium in Italy with local authorities. After lengthy negotiations and careful rehabilitation, a few days ago they returned to the sea. Good luck Genoveffa and Gavino!

SAVING RARE TIGERS

Just 350 Indochinese tigers remain but, with your help, we work to keep them safe in Thailand’s dense jungle. Our Freeland colleagues identify each tiger’s unique stripes and camera traps carry out the equivalent of 26,000 nights of surveys. Thanks to everyone who donated to our recent Tigers in Crisis ( [link removed] ) Appeal, raising more than £50,000 to keep wild tigers safe.

WHAT A DIFFERENCE YOU MAKE!

Lion brothers Jora and Black were subdued and bored when we rescued them from a rusty circus trailer in 2016. But, look at them now! They’re clearly flourishing at our sanctuary in South Africa, surrounded by the sights and sounds of their ancestral homeland.
